In cool mode, the air conditioner takes in hot air and runs it through the compressor so as to cool the air before blowing it out into the room. Cool mode is the default mode in which the air conditioner operates (i.e There are four modes on your controller: COOL operation for cooling HEAT operation for heating AUTO operation selects an appropriate operation mode (COOL or HEAT) based on the indoor temperature and starts the operation DRY operation eliminates humidity while maintaining the indoor temperature as much as possible
